It came down to the top three vocalists on May 12th's American Idol. This determination had significance as the final three contestants will now return to their hometowns for parades, a concert and much adulation.

The Drama

The contestants' families were brought onto the stage for moral support. Casey was told early on that he was safe. However, when announcer Ryan Seacrest said, "Casey..." with that forlorn tone he uses, Casey nodded and looked down at the floor, seemingly ready to hear that he was in the bottom two. However, they didn't announce a bottom two; it was all random and Casey was safe. I was glad to hear it...not because of his good looks, but because he's talented.

Crystal, Mike and Lee waited a while longer to receive their fate. When Ryan told Lee that he would be heading back to Chicago, I wondered if he meant Lee was kicked off the show or was going to his hometown celebration parade. It was the latter. I would've been disappointed had Lee been finished. Then again, stranger things have happened. After all, Chris Daughtry only made it to fourth runner-up in American Idol's fifth season back in 2006.

It was finally down to Crystal and Mike. I actually had the thought that Crystal might go-only because it seemed too obvious to pair her against Michael Lynche. When the drama unfolded, Mike found out his luck had run out. Crystal will still be around, and that's good news in my book.

The Top Three

Crystal Bowersox is looking forward to getting back to her old stomping grounds in Elliston, Ohio, and jamming with her base player, Frankie Ray.

Lee DeWyze watched clips of former American Idols as they experienced their homecomings and said, "I want that to be me." He's getting his wish as he heads back to Prospect, Illinois.

Casey James said he has a hankering to hear 'a bunch of people say y'all'. There'll be no shortage of that phrase when he lands in Fort Worth, Texas.
